Possible Causes of Water Damage to Your Flooring
Water damage to your flooring in Lacy-Lakeview can happen unexpectedly, often due to household plumbing issues, burst pipes, or leaks from appliances. Heavy rainstorms or flooding in the area can also seep into homes, causing significant harm to hardwood, laminate, or carpeted floors. Understanding the root causes is the first step toward effective restoration.
Often, water infiltrates through cracked foundation walls or poorly sealed windows, allowing moisture to reach the flooring. Over time, these issues weaken the structural integrity of your floors, leading to mold growth, warping, or rotting. Recognizing these causes early can prevent further damage and costly repairs down the line.

What signs indicate I need water damaged flooring removal?
Visible water stains, warping, or buckling of your floors are clear signs. If you notice a persistent musty smell or mold growth, it’s time to call our experts. Prompt action can prevent further structural damage.

Will my flooring be completely replaced after water damage?
Not necessarily. In some cases, if the damage is superficial, repairs and drying may suffice. However, severely compromised flooring usually requires full replacement for safety and durability.
How can I prevent future water damage in my home?
Regular maintenance, inspecting pipes, sealing windows, and improving drainage around your property can prevent water infiltration. Our team can also advise on additional protective measures tailored to your home.
